ROMAN GLASS UNGUENTARIUM
2ND-4TH CENTURY A.D.
6 1/8 in. (97 grams, 15.5 cm).

With piriform body and flat base, tall neck with waisted joint to body, mouth with everted rim; old collector's labels to underside 'L-15439' and '2970'. [No Reserve]

PROVENANCE:
with H.A.C., Basel, prior 1999.
This lot is accompanied by an illustrated lot declaration signed by the Head of the Antiquities Department, Dr Raffaele D’Amato.

LITERATURE:
Cf. Whitehouse, D., Roman Glass in the Corning Museum of Glass, vol.2, New York, 2001, item 772, for type.
